So, 'Recrutement' is this intriguing gem from 2001 that treads a curious line between reality and the absurd. The film sets a unique tone, effectively capturing the awkwardness of job interviews but with an offbeat twist. It explores themes of identity and self-worth in a subtly unsettling manner. The performances feel genuine, adding a layer of relatability, while the pacing keeps you engaged without feeling rushed. It's distinct for its practical effects that enhance the surreal atmosphere without overshadowing the narrative. Definitely not your standard interview flick, it's one of those films that leaves you pondering long after it's over.
'Recrutement' is a bit of an under-the-radar title, not widely distributed and a bit of a curiosity for collectors. It hasn’t seen a lot of re-releases, making original formats quite sought after. There’s a certain intrigue about how it blends mundane reality with surrealism, which often sparks conversations among collectors about its unique narrative approach and performances.
